Why have consulates become so strict?
Spanish law (Org. Law 4/2000) states that foreigners must have access to the same level of healthcare as Spanish citizens. The state-run SNS (Sistema Nacional de Salud) does not require payment for each visit to a physician. Therefore, if your insurance requires a co-payment (even a symbolic 5 euros), it is considered “incomplete.”
It’s important to understand the difference between insurance coverage and payment type. You can have coverage for a million euros, but if the contract type is “Con Copagos,” the official will mark it as inconsistent. This has been the most common reason for digital nomad visa denials in the past year.

What are waiting periods (Carencias) and how to remove them?
Waiting periods are insurance company “protection” against clients who purchase a policy only to have expensive surgery the next day and then cancel the contract. The typical period is 3 to 8 months. However, to obtain a residence permit, it is crucial that the insurance coverage be fully effective from day one.
Some companies (such as DKV) may waive these waiting periods for certain visa types when applying through a certified agent. This is called a “Carencias Elimination.” Always check for this document when applying for residency.
Checklist for checking your policy:
- The contract or certificate contains the phrase “Sin copagos” or “Asistencia completa“.
- The policy is valid for at least 1 year (some consulates require an annual fee).
- Repatriation coverage (Repatriación de restos mortales) is included in the basic package.
- There are no limits on hospital stays.
